The Annual Congress is an inspiring, thought-provoking and entertaining opportunity to exchange ideas and hear leading-edge thinking from urbanists around the globe. It is an opportunity to embed the Academy within a city and utilise the assembled expertise of Academicians to tackle live local issues through hands-on workshops, walking tours and discussions.
Past hosts include Eindhoven, Cork, Copenhagen, Dublin, Sheffield, Manchester, Glasgow, NewcastleGateshead, Bradford and Bristol. The success of Congress owes as much to the background and passions of its participants as to the insights and inspiration of the invited presenters.
